如何从同一解决方案中的第二个项目的控制器派生

时间:2012-01-14 16:43:41

标签: c# asp.net asp.net-mvc-3

我正在使用C#和mvc3。我在解决方案中添加了一个项目。我想创建一个新的控制器,让它来自我添加的项目内的控制器。我怎么能这样做?

2 个答案:

答案 0 :(得分:1)

将原始控制器或更可能创建一个仅包含您要共享的功能的控制器作为基本控制器移动到新的类库项目中。让两个Web项目都包含库作为参考,让控制器都来自基本控制器。

答案 1 :(得分:1)

在Visual Studio中,您可以add a reference到第二个项目。然后导入名称空间,然后就可以了。